BUTTERFLIED ROAST CHICKEN
Whether it is for a family dinner or a small holiday gathering, this Butterflied Roast Chicken is marinated with lemon and rosemary flavours and roasted to juicy perfection.

Steps:
- Pat the chicken dry with paper towel. Flip the bird breast side down. Using kitchen or poultry shears, cut alongside the backbone about 1 inch from the center. Then make the same cut along the other side and remove the backbone (save and freeze for homemade chicken stock in the slow cooker or Instant Pot).
- Make a small cut at the beginning of the breast bone. This will make the bird lay flat. Cut away any extra skin or fatty parts and pat dry the inside as well. Transfer butterflied chicken breast side up to a casserole or simmer dish.
- To make the marinade, in a small bowl whisk together olive oil, lemon juice, minced garlic, and minced rosemary.
- Season the entire top side of the the chicken with salt and pepper. Then spoon about half of the marinade over the bird. Rub the seasoning and marinade all over with your hands to make sure every part of the skin is covered.
- Flip the butterflied chicken over and repeat with more salt, pepper, and the rest of the marinade.
- Let the chicken marinate for at least half an hour (at room temperature) or overnight (in the fridge).
- When you are ready to roast the spatchcock chicken, preheat the oven and a large cast iron pan to 500°F. Put the preheated pan on a cutting board and place the chicken breast side down inside of it.
- Arrange the lemon slices and rosemary sprigs on top and around the chicken.
- Turn the oven heat down to 450°F and bake the chicken for 30 minutes.
- Then flip the chicken around and roast about 15 minutes more until the internal temperature at breast reaches 160°F and 175°F at the thigh.
- Let the chicken rest over with a pan or aluminum foil for 15 minutes before carving.
- To carve, make a cut where the wing attached to the breast. Then separate the leg, and divide the leg into thigh and drumstick pieces. Separate the 2 breast pieces and cut away the ribs from behind. Then slice the breast into even strips.
BUTTERFLIED CHICKEN
Steps:
- Mix the chopped rosemary, garlic, lemon zest, lemon juice, 1 tablespoon olive oil, 2 teaspoons salt and 1/2 teaspoon pepper together in a small bowl to make a paste.
- Place the chickens on a sheet pan, skin side up, and loosen the skin from the meat with your fingers. Place 1/2 of the paste under the skin of each chicken. Rub any remaining paste on the outside and underside of the chickens.
- Turn the chicken skin side down and scatter the lemon slices and sprigs of rosemary over each chicken. Season with salt and pepper. Roll each chicken up, cover with plastic wrap and refrigerate for at least 1 hour.
- Heat a grill with coals. Spread the coals out in 1 dense layer and brush the grill with oil. Unroll the chickens, place them on the grill and cook for 12 minutes on each side.
BUTTERFLIED CHICKEN WITH ROSEMARY, GARLIC AND LEMON RECIPE - (4/5)

Steps:
- First, preheat the oven to 400 F. Then, rinse the chicken (including the cavity) and dry the beast thoroughly with paper towels. Place it on a cutting board (with an optional sheet of wax paper underneath for cleanliness), breast side down and backbone side up. Arrange it so that the neck is facing you. Cut along either side of the backbone. You'll hear some crunches, but shouldn't encounter any major obstacles. If you do, adjust your course accordingly. Once you've cut all the way through, cut through the left side as well and simply remove the entire backbone. Remove the backbone and throw it away. At this point you'll see some extra skin and fat hanging around the bottom-cut that out. Turn the chicken over, and firmly press on the breastbone to break it. Now that the chicken is splayed out, pat it dry again with more paper towels (the drier you can get it, the crisper the skin will bake up). Spread a layer of parchment paper on a large baking sheet, and slap the butterflied chicken on it, skin side up. Pour the olive oil over the chicken, sprinkle on the rosemary leaves, thyme, lemon pepper, and generously season it with salt and pepper, spreading the oil and seasoning over the entire surface with your fingers. Break apart the head of garlic. Roughly chop the lemon into 6 pieces. Distribute the garlic and lemon all around and underneath the chicken. You can stuff some garlic under the skin if you want to add to the flavor. Toss a couple whole sprigs of rosemary underneath it. Roast it for 35-45 minutes (test for doneness at 35). And let me add-please don't overcook it. If the juices are running clear, you're probably good to go. But the difference between a chicken overcooked by 10 minutes (starting to get dry and fibrous) and a perfectly cooked chicken (think al dente pasta) is amazing. When it's moist and just done, it's an experience to be treasured bite by bite. Overcooking makes it mediocre and blah. The USDA will tell you to go to 170 in the breast, but keep in mind that their recommendation errs on the high end. The dry end. The fibrous end. I cooked my chicken to 160 in the thick part of the breast. For my taste, perfect! Optional step: 10 minutes before it's done, you can grab a stick of butter and smear it over the top. This will give the skin the lovely golden brown color.
ROAST CHICKEN WITH LEMON, GARLIC, AND ROSEMARY
Roast chicken could not be easier - or tastier - than with this recipe. Lemon, rosemary, and garlic help to flavor this gloriously roasted chicken with crispy skin.

Steps:
- Preheat the oven to 450 degrees F (230 degrees C).
- Pat chicken dry and sprinkle salt on all sides and inside the cavity. Sprinkle with black pepper. Pluck the leaves from 1 spring of rosemary and sprinkle on the chicken. Place the other whole sprig inside the cavity along with garlic and lemon.
- Place the chicken on a roasting rack set inside a roasting pan.
- Bake in the preheated oven until no longer pink at the bone and the juices run clear, about 1 hour. An instant-read thermometer inserted into the thickest part of the thigh, near the bone, should read 165 degrees F (74 degrees C).
